SEC Appoints Crypto-Savvy Leaders Signaling Potentially More Bitcoin-Friendly Regulatory Approach

The U.S.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C) has recently appointed four senior executives, including two with significant expertise in digital assets, signaling a strategic shift under Chairman Paul Atkins. Effective June 17, Jamie Selway will lead the Division of Trading and Markets, bringing extensive experience from his tenure as Partner at Sophron Advisors and his prior role as Global Head of Institutional Markets at Blockchain. Meanwhile, Brian T. Daly is slated to become Director of the Division of Investment Management starting July 8. These appointments underscore the SEC’s commitment to integrating seasoned professionals with deep knowledge of crypto markets and blockchain technology, potentially fostering a more nuanced regulatory framework. Market participants should closely monitor how these leadership changes influence the SEC’s approach to digital asset oversight and capital market regulations.
